Dr. Kalpana Sangwan    

Dr. Kalpana Sangwan is a Senior Vitreo-Retina and Uveitis Specialist at Ekaayi Healthcare Centers, New Delhi, with over a decade of experience in managing complex retinal disorders. A Fellow of the International Council of Ophthalmology and formally trained at the prestigious Aravind Eye Hospitals (F.V.R.S.), She has performed over 10,000 retinal surgeries, 25000 cataract surgeries and 25,000 retinal laser procedures.

Her clinical expertise lies in suture-less vitrectomy and the management of diabetic retinopathy, polypoidal choroidal vasculopathy (PCV), and age-related macular degeneration. Dr. Sangwan was honored with the Young Ophthalmologist Award (2020) for her contributions to innovative retinal care. Dr. Kalpana Sangwan
Chief Vitreoretinal Surgeon – Ekaayi Visioncare & Ekaayi Medcare Center, New Delhi
Senior Consultant – Vitreo-Retina and Uveitis

Dr. Kalpana Sangwan is a distinguished Vitreoretinal and Uveitis Specialist, currently serving as the Chief Vitreoretinal Surgeon at Ekaayi Visioncare and Ekaayi Medcare Center, New Delhi. With over a decade of clinical and surgical experience, she is recognized for her excellence in managing complex retinal disorders using evidence-based and patient-focused approaches.
A Fellow in Vitreoretinal Surgery from the prestigious Aravind Eye Hospital (F.V.R.S.) and a Fellow of the International Council of Ophthalmology, Dr. Sangwan has successfully performed over 13,500 vitreoretinal surgeries, 35,000+ laser photocoagulation procedures, and 10,500 phacoemulsification surgeries, including numerous combined retinal and cataract procedures.
Her clinical interests include age-related macular degeneration (ARMD), polypoidal choroidal vasculopathy (PCV), diabetic retinopathy, retinal dystrophies, and retinal vascular disorders, with ongoing focus on interventional research in ARMD.
Dr. Sangwan has received extensive training in pediatric retina under Dr. Parag Shah at Aravind Eye Hospital, Coimbatore, with hands-on experience in conditions like Retinopathy of Prematurity (ROP), Retinoblastoma, and FEVR. Her academic and surgical background is further strengthened by advanced diagnostic expertise in Spectral Domain OCT, Fundus Fluorescein Angiography, and Electrophysiological testing (ERG, EOG).
